Job Overview

TLC Nursing Associates, Inc. is seeking a highly skilled Registered Nurse (RN) – Intensive Care Unit (ICU) to provide specialized nursing care to critically ill patients. The ICU RN will monitor patient conditions, administer treatments, and coll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to ensure optimal patient outcomes.

Responsibilities

  • Provide comprehensive care to critically ill patients in the ICU
  • Monitor vital signs, ventilators, and life-support equipment
  • Administer medications, IV fluids, and blood products as prescribed
  • Assess patient responses and adjust treatment plans accordingly
  • Collaborate with physicians, specialists, and healthcare teams to optimize patient outcomes
  • Educate patients and families on critical care plans and post-ICU recovery
  • Maintain accurate patient records and ensure compliance with hospital protocols
  • Follow strict infection control and safety procedures

Qualifications

  • Active RN license in applicable state(s)
  • Minimum 1–2 years of ICU experience preferred
  • Certification in Basic Life Support (BLS) and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) required
  • Strong knowledge of ventilators, hemodynamic monitoring, and critical care protocols
  • Ability to work in a high-pressure and fast-paced environment
